For a large number of wireless sensor networking applications are dependent on the location information of nodes, that in this new field of research WSN, the network node itself is the current positioning of scientists need to solve challenging research topic, it must be meet the costs within the limits of the sensor nodes, energy and volume, reaching positioning capability low-power, low cost, low complexity and high-precision wireless sensor network nodes.Microelectronics system for wireless sensor networking can have a lot of monitor abilities. This system’s points are voice and vibration. Because the condition of video monitor is always very harshly, and it can’t cover whole of the place. But the voice and vibration monitor system doesn’t have these problems and could be hidden very well. When a event happen, this system can monitor the single quickly and send a warning message. This system has flexible using environment and reliable monitor methord.Throughout the article the whole chapter, first of all, a large number of papers on the basis of the literature review on the present situation at home and abroad based on WSN technology, and pointed out the hardware and software system components and wireless sensor network nodes composition; through and go wireless Internet Compared to explore the Internet and its inherent performance benefits of diversification of use; followed analyse how to realize the abilities of this system’s each part:the hardware circuit and software program. At the same time, the paper also explain the methord of how to control the sensor’s power., give a complete low-power scheme to make sure the system can work stablely for a long time.
